Lahore: Sheikhupura properties of former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if will be auctioned on May 20.

According to details, the Deputy Commissioner (DC) Sheikhupura has set a date to auction properties of Pakistan Muslim Leagu-Nawaz (PML-N) supremo.
Meanwhile, the bidding decision of DC Sheikhupura has been challenged in the Islamabad High Court (IHC).
The petitioner Ashraf Malik in his plea has argued that he had purchased the 88 kanals of land in Sheikhupura from former premier and had also made the payment of Rs. 75 million.
He stated that following the arrest of PML-N leader, the sale deed could not be implemented and he has also moved civil court for the implementation of the sale deed.
Another petitioner named Aslam Aziz has also challenged the decision to auction 105 acres of fruit orchards in Lahore in the court requesting it to halt the process.
“Even my initial investment has been paid off,” the plaintiff added.
